Meet Dr. Sergio Rodriguez

Dr. Sergio Rodriguez is board certified by the American Board of Surgery. He specializes in disorders and injuries afflicting the hand, wrist, forearms and elbows.

Dr. S. Rodriguez received his medical degree in 1991 from the Universidad Catolica de Cordoba in Cordoba, Argentina & completed his Orthopedic Surgery residency at the Dupuytren Institute in Buenos Aires, Argentina. Dr. Rodriguez subsequently moved to the United States in 2002 where he completed a General Surgery Residency at the St. Elizabeth Health Center in Youngstown, Ohio. After his residency, he went on to complete a Hand and Upper Extremity Surgery Fellowship at the prestigious Philadelphia Hand Center at Thomas Jefferson University in Philadelphia, PA.

Dr. S. Rodriguez has given numerous presentations on a variety of disorders affecting the upper and lower extremities. Current research interests and publications include Rehabilitation of the Hand and Upper Extremity, Treatment of Symptomatic Neuromas of the Dorsal Radial Sensory Nerve using a resorbable nerve conduit, and Triplanar Osteotomies for Distal Radius Malunions. His work is awaiting publication.

Dr. S. Rodriguez is a member of the American Society for Surgery of the Hand, American College of Surgeons, American Medical Association, Ohio State Medical Association, and of the Mahoning County Medical Society.
